What affects the price

When you look at final expense plans, the price isn't one-size-fits-all. Insurance companies calculate your rate based on a few main things. First, your current age plays a big role; applying sooner is generally more affordable. Your health history is the second factor, as carriers want to understand your overall risk profile. They also look at your tobacco use and whether you prefer a plan that covers you immediately or one that has a waiting period. These details help determine your monthly premium.

How does final expense insurance work for covering burial costs?

Final expense insurance works by providing a death benefit that's specifically meant to cover end-of-life expenses, like burial or cremation in Long Beach. When you pass away, the policy pays out to your designated beneficiary, who can then use the funds for these costs. This prevents your family from having to dip into savings or take out loans. It’s a straightforward way to ensure these final arrangements are taken care of without burdening your loved ones. This coverage is designed for simplicity and peace of mind.

How do burial and final expense insurance differ?

Burial insurance and final expense insurance are essentially the same type of product. Both are designed to cover the costs associated with a funeral, burial, or cremation. The terms are often used interchangeably. The primary goal of both is to alleviate the financial burden on your family for these end-of-life expenses.
